html, body {height : 100%;}
body {background-color : #6c564b;font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px;
margin : 0;padding : 0;border : 0;} 
.clearall { clear: both; }
div.centre2blanc {height : auto;width : auto;max-width : 1500px;margin : auto;text-align : center;}
div.centre3blanc {height : auto;width : auto;max-width : 750px;margin : auto;text-align : center;}
div.centrele600 { height :auto;width :100%; max-width :1200px; margin :auto; text-align :left; } 
div.anti_menu {position : fixed;top : 0px;left : 0px;width:100%}
div.mon_orange_rose {background-color : #ff9966;}
div.bande_haut {z-index : 1;background : url("logossmala/stmichel.jpg") top center repeat-x transparent;
background-size : cover;min-height : 250px;height : 250px;width : 100%;text-align : center;}
div.home {position : fixed;top : 4px;left : 4px;overflow : hidden;z-index : 50;}
div.Limage {position : fixed;top : 170px;right : 0;z-index : -12;overflow : hidden;visibility : visible !important ;}
div.User {z-index : 30;position : fixed;padding-bottom : 0;padding-left : 0;padding-right : 0;overflow : hidden;top : 150px;padding-top : 0;left : 0;}
div.monHaut {position : fixed;text-align : center;width : 100%;height : 160px;top : 0;left : 0;margin : 0;padding : 0;border : 0;
overflow : hidden;background-image : url("logossmala/fox.jpg");}
div.centre2 {width : auto;margin : auto;text-align : center;max-width : 1000px;}
div.centre2Left {text-align : left;margin : auto;width : 80%;}
div.blogcentre {text-align : center;}
div.centre0 {width : 90%;margin : auto;text-align : left;}
div.centre1X {height : 350px;width : auto;max-width : 500px;margin : auto;text-align : center;}
div.centre2X {width : auto;max-width : 500px;margin : auto;} 
span.leTitre {font-family: "Times New Roman", Times, serif;font-size : 48px;color : #aaaaaa;}
span.LaFonte_blog {font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;}
span.LaFonte_blog_left {text-align : left;font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;}
span.LaFonte_rouge {font-family: "Times New Roman", Times, serif;color : #ee5555;font-size : 22px !important ;}
span.codephp {font-family: "Times New Roman", Times, serif;color : #ddeeff;font-size : 18px !important ;}
/* _________________________________________ */
/* =================pagination================== */
.pagination { text-align: center; margin: 20px auto;font-size: 20px;font-family: Arial, "Trebuchet MS", Tahoma, Verdana, Sans-Serif;}
.pagination .page_actuelle { margin: 2px;padding: 2px 2px;border: 2px solid #AAAAAA;background-color: #C8C8C8;color: #aaaaaa;}
.pagination .desactive {margin: 2px;padding: 2px 2px;border: 2px solid #E2E2E2;color: #aaaaaa;}
.pagination a {margin: 2px;padding: 2px 2px;border: 2px solid #D9D9D9;color: #aaaaaa;}
.pagination a:hover, .pagination a:focus, .pagination a:active {border: 2px solid #D9D9D9;text-decoration: none;}

.main_wrapper table {width:100%;border:1px solid #333;background-color:##6c564c;}
.main_wrapper table th {padding:5px;background-color:#333;color:##6c564c;}
.main_wrapper table tr:nth-child(even) {}
.main_wrapper table td {border-bottom:1px solid #aaa;padding-left:10px;}
.main_wrapper tr:hover {background-color:##6c564c;}

/* ____________________________________________________________ */
p.Leleft {text-align : justify;font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;}
p.Leleft2 {text-align : left;font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;}
p.Center {text-align : center;font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;}
a.LesAcoryght {font-family: "Times New Roman", Times, serif;color :#feffff; font-size :22px !important; text-decoration :none;}
a.LesAcoryght:hover { color :#eeaaaa; }
a.lemenu {color : #feffff;text-decoration : none;font-size : 22px;}
a.lemenu:hover {color : #eeaaaa;}
a.LesA {font-family: "Times New Roman", Times, serif;color : #ffffff;font-size : 16px;text-decoration : none;}
a.LesA:hover {color : #eeaaaa;}
a.LesA3 {font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 22px !important ;text-decoration : none;}
a.LesA3:hover {color : #eeaaaa;}
a.LesA12 {font-family: "Times New Roman", Times, serif;color : #ffffff;font-size : 22px;text-decoration : none;}
a.LesA12:hover {color : #eeaaaa;}
a.LesA16 {font-family: "Times New Roman", Times, serif;color : #ffffff;font-size : 22px;text-decoration : none;}
a.LesA16:hover {color : #eeaaaa;}
a.LesA16R {font-family: "Times New Roman", Times, serif;font-size : 22px;color : #ff5555;text-decoration : none;}
a.LesA16R:hover {color : #eeaaaa;}
a.LesA16x {font-family: "Courier New", Courier, monospace;color : #ffffff;font-size : 22px;text-decoration : none;}
a.LesA16x:hover {color : #eeaaaa;}
a.LesAHaut {font-family: "Times New Roman", Times, serif;font-size : 22px;color : #ffffff;text-decoration : none;border-bottom : 1px;line-height : 200%;}
a.LesAHaut:hover {color : #eeaaaa;}
a.LesAC {font-family: "Times New Roman", Times, serif;color : #ffffff;text-decoration : none;border-bottom : 1px;line-height : 200%;}
a.LesAC {color : #eeaaaa;}
input.LeSubmite {width : 100px;margin-left : auto;margin-right : auto;}
span#u_0_2 {color : #ffffff !important ;}

object {z-index : -12;}
span.LaFonte_blog {font-family: "Times New Roman", Times, serif;color : #feffff;font-size : 24px !important ;}
span.LaFonte_rouge {font-family: "Times New Roman", Times, serif;color : #ee5555;font-size : 24px !important ;}
button.blog {font-weight : bold;z-index : 100;width : 150px;color : #ffffff;background : none 0% 0% repeat scroll transparent;}
barre {text-decoration : line-through;}
blockquote.encadre {background : #7E9FC6;color : #FFFFFF;border : #dbdbdb solid 1px;margin : 1px 1px 1px 15px;overflow : auto;}
p.voir {border-right : 1px solid #456B99;}
img.leleft {border-bottom : medium none;border-left : medium none;margin : 0 1em 0.5em 0;float : left;border-top : medium none;
border-right : medium none;}
img.levide {width : 250px;height : 150px;}
img.imgnew {border : ##6c564c solid 1px;}
img.imgnew:hover {border : #db2222 solid 1px;}
img.le680 {width : 680px;border : none;}
img.leleft {float : left;margin : 0 1em 0.5em 0;border : none;}
img.lesliens {float : left; margin:10px; border: 5px solid #ffffff; }
img.lesliens2 {float : left; margin:10px; }
img.fade {position : absolute;}
img.fade2 {position: relative;top: 0px;left: 0px;}
img.le680 {border-bottom : medium none;border-left : medium none;width : 680px;border-top : medium none;border-right : medium none;}
img.bande {width : 90%;}
img.bande2 {width : 80%;max-width : 800px;}
/* _____________________saisie fox_________________________ */
div.blogsaisie {height : auto;width : auto;max-width : 600px;margin : auto;text-align : center;}
form.blogsaisie {border : #ffffff solid 1px;padding : 22px;width : auto;border-radius : 10px;}
label.saisie_commentaire {text-align : right;width : 100px;display : inline-block;font-size : 14px;vertical-align : top;font-weight : bold;margin-right : 22px;}
input.saisie_commentaire {background-color : #F2F2F2;border : #557bee solid 1px;padding : 4px;width : 200px;border-radius : 10px;}
input.saisie_commentaire {background-color : #F2F2F2;border : #557bee solid 1px;padding : 4px;width : 200px;border-radius : 10px;}
textarea.saisie_commentaire {background-color : #f2f2f2;border : #557bee solid 1px;padding : 4px;width : 200px;height : 5em;border-radius : 10px;}

/* __________________________________________________________ */

/* ===================saisie  DVD detail================= */

input    {font-family: Verdana; font-size: 16px; color : #000000; }
textarea {font-family: Verdana; font-size: 16px; color : #000000; }

input.Boutons_saisie2 {background-color: #267474;}
/*
form.blogsaisie2 {border-bottom:rgb(255,255,255) 1px solid;border-left:rgb(255,255,255) 1px solid;
padding-bottom:20px;padding-left:20px;padding-right:20px;border-top:rgb(255,255,255) 1px solid;border-right:rgb(255,255,255) 1px solid;
padding-top:20px;-webkit-box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;
box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;border-top-left-radius:20px;
border-top-right-radius:20px;border-bottom-right-radius:20px;border-bottom-left-radius:20px;width:auto;}
*/

label.saisie2_commentaire {text-align:right;width:100px;display:inline-block;font-size:14px;vertical-align:top;font-weight:bold;margin-right:20px;}
input.saisie2_commentaire {border-bottom:rgb(170,170,170) 1px solid;border-left:rgb(170,170,170) 1px solid;padding-bottom:4px;
background-color:rgb(242,242,242);padding-left:4px;WIDTH:200px;padding-right:4px;VERTICAL-ALIGN:top;
border-top:rgb(170,170,170) 1px solid;border-right:rgb(170,170,170) 1px solid;
padding-top:4px;-webkit-box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;
box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;border-top-left-radius:10px;border-top-right-radius:10px;
border-bottom-right-radius:10px;border-bottom-left-radius:10px;}
textarea.saisie2_commentaire {border-bottom:rgb(170,170,170) 1px solid;border-left:rgb(170,170,170) 1px solid;padding-bottom:4px;
background-color:rgb(242,242,242);padding-left:4px;WIDTH:400px;padding-right:4px;VERTICAL-ALIGN:top;HEIGHT:200px;
border-top:rgb(170,170,170) 1px solid;border-right:rgb(170,170,170) 1px solid;
padding-top:4px; -webkit-box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;
box-shadow:rgb(221, 221, 221) -1px -1px 0px, rgb(221, 221, 221) -1px -1px 0px inset;border-top-left-radius:10px;border-top-right-radius:10px;
border-bottom-right-radius:10px;border-bottom-left-radius:10px;}
input.lesubmite2 {background:#6F6F6F;align:center;}
div.arrondi {width: auto;padding: 10px;background-color :#4F4F4F;-moz-border-radius: 10px;-webkit-border-radius: 10px;border-radius: 10px;}

/* ___________________________________________________________ */
.menu-carre2 {width : 330px;height : 255px;margin : 0 0.8% 0.8% 0;position : relative;float : left;display : inline;border : #000000 solid 2px;overflow : hidden;}
.menu-carre3 {width : 330px;height : 255px;margin : 0 0.8% 0.8% 0;position : relative;float : left;display : inline;border : #000000 solid 2px;overflow : hidden;}
p.le300 { width:325px;height:252px;line-height:225px;text-align:center; }
img.im300 { vertical-align:middle; }
img.imlogo { vertical-align:middle; }
div.mescarres { width: 270px;  border: 1px solid black; text-align: center; padding: 1px 1px 1px 1px; display:inline-block; margin:1px 1px 1px 1px;}  
img.mescarres {  width: 250px;border: 0px;}
/* ____________________media1024______________________ */
@media screen and (max-width: 1024px) {
div.centre2blanc {height : auto;width : auto;max-width : 90%;margin : 22px ;text-align : center;}
div.Limage {position : fixed;top : 170px;right : 0;z-index : -12;overflow : hidden;visibility : hidden !important ;}
div.home {position : fixed;top : 4px;left : 4px;overflow : hidden;z-index : 50;}
span.leTitre {font-family: "Times New Roman", Times, serif;font-size : 20px;color : #aaaaaa;}
}
/* __________________________media 640_____________________ */
@media (max-width:640px) {
body, element1, element2 {width : auto;margin : 0;padding : 0;}
div.bande_haut {z-index : 1;position : absolute;top : 22px;left : 0;
background : url("logossmala/paris_trocadero_tour_eiffel.jpg") top center repeat-x transparent;
background-size : cover;min-height : 150px;height : 150px;width : 100%;text-align : center;}
img,blockquote, pre, textarea, input, iframe, object, embed, video {max-width : 100%;}
img {height : auto;width : auto;box-sizing : border-box;}
img.fade {width : 90%;position : absolute;}
div.centre0X {width : 90%;margin : auto;height : 375px;}
textarea, pre, samp {overflow-wrap : break-word;hyphens : auto;}
pre, samp {white-space : pre-wrap;}
element1, element2 {float : none;width : auto;}
.hide_mobile {display : none !important ;}
body:before {content : "Version mobile du site";display : block;color : #999999;text-align : center;font-style : italic;}
span.leTitre {font-family: "Times New Roman", Times, serif;font-size : 20px;color : #aaaaaa;}
div.centre2blanc {height : auto;width : auto;max-width : 90%;margin : 22px ;text-align : center;}
div.Limage {position : fixed;top : 170px;right : 0;z-index : -12;overflow : hidden;visibility : hidden !important ;}
div.home {position : fixed;top : 4px;left : 4px;overflow : hidden;z-index : 50;}
}